Summary

The land-cover thematic accuracy of NLCD 2001 was assessed from a probability-sample of 15,000 pixels. NLCD 2001 overall Anderson Level II and Level I accuracies were 78.7% and 85.3%, respectively. Accuracy results are reported for 10 geographic regions of the United States, with regional overall accuracies ranging from 68% to 86% for Level II and from 79% to 91% at Level I. Geographic variation in class-specific accuracy was strongly associated with the phenomenon that regionally more abundant land-cover classes had higher accuracy.
